Northampton Town players to receive ceremonial scroll at civic reception
The scroll will be presented by Councillor Phil Larratt as part of a civic reception at Northampton’s Guildhall on Sunday, May 8.
Councillor Larratt said: “Northampton Town FC have had a tremendous season, which firstly saw them promoted to League One and then crowned league champions.

Hide Ad“This is a marvellous achievement and I’m very proud of everyone involved with the club and delighted for the fans, for whom this means so much.
“Such an exceptional performance has brought prestige to Northampton, creating a positive focus on the county town of Northamptonshire.
“I’m also delighted that Towcester Mill Brewery has agreed to assist in sponsoring the civic reception. This is a fantastic independent small brewery based in the Old Mill in the centre of Towcester within the county, producing excellent beers.”
Additionally, footway restrictions on Black Lion Hill put in place for highways works are due to be temporarily lifted so football fans for the parade can have access.
